Summary
Wallace Montgomery is seeking a Senior Construction Inspector to join our team. The position involves inspecting, observing, and documenting construction and maintenance projects, performing tests on soils and materials. Work is performed under a Project Engineer and often under a client’s employee. Inspectors travel across the state, may work night shift, and must hold a valid driver’s license with reliable transportation.
Essential Functions
- Perform field inspections of construction and maintenance projects, including existing roadways, structures, and facilities.
- Conduct and observe tests on soils, asphalt, concrete, aggregates, bituminous products, metal products, and industrial coatings.
- Respond to data requests.
- Participate in traffic control activities.
- Complete the Inspector's Daily Report (IDR) documenting labor, equipment, and material used each day.
- Maintain daily progress photos.
- File Force Account records for unresolved changes when work must still be performed.
- Maintain a construction sketchbook containing documentation.
- Reconcile pay quantities on progress payments submitted by the Contractor.
- Attend meetings as needed.
- Participate in change order negotiations when appropriate.
- Participate in CPM schedule meetings when appropriate.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or GED.
- Valid driver’s license (company vehicle provided).
- Seven (7) years of experience on a mix of projects such as interstate widening, bridges, paving, soils, or heavy equipment.
- VDOT transportation project experience preferred.
Certifications Required (Active Throughout Contract)
- Soil and Aggregate Compaction – NICET LevelII.
- Asphalt Field LevelI.
- Asphalt Field LevelII.
- Hydraulic Cement Concrete Field – ACI Concrete Field LevelI, or WACEL ConcreteI, or NICET LevelII.
- Pavement Marking.
- GRIT (Guardrail Certification).
- Virginia DEQ Erosion and Sediment Control Inspection Certification.
- Virginia DEQ Stormwater Management (Inspector) Certification.
- Nuclear Gauge Safety Training – Nuclear Regulatory Commission recognized provider.
- Intermediate Work Zone Traffic Control – VDOT approved provider.
- 10‑Hour OSHA Safety Training.
